I now understand 'larger customization ...' to mean supplying a trace function
other than the default, to do something with 'cmd' other than just print it.
For instance, one could record tcl commands in a file and later count the tcl
function calls, much like python's trace does. To do that, I believe you could
just replace 'def trace ... with
if iscallable(value):
trace = value
else:
def trace ...
+1 on adding this. The default trace would be useful for simple interaction,
but less so for what I tried to do above, which is to trace a complete IDLE
session.
